/*
|
||||
This is for prepared statement validation purposes.
|
||||
A statement looks up and pre-loads all its stored functions
|
||||
at prepare. Later on, if a function is gone from the cache,
|
||||
execute may fail.
|
||||
Remember the cache version to be able to invalidate the prepared
|
||||
statement at execute if it changes.
|
||||
We only need to care about version of the stored functions cache:
|
||||
if a prepared statement uses a stored procedure, it's indirect,
|
||||
via a stored function. The only exception is SQLCOM_CALL,
|
||||
but the latter one looks up the stored procedure each time
|
||||
it's invoked, rather than once at prepare.
|
||||
*/
|
||||
m_sp_cache_version= sp_cache_version(&thd->sp_func_cache);
